BladestarringMahershala Aliis already behind production due to major delays but it’s only delving deeper into problems. Recently,Kit Harington, who was rumored to star in the upcoming film has acknowledged his inclusion and it’s not pleasant.

Black Knight by Marvel

His Dane Whitman character was first spotted in one of the post-credit scenes forEternals,picking up his family’s legacy sword meanwhile a background voice (later confirmed to be Ali) asked,“Are you sure you’re ready for that?”

That eventually began to speculate the theory of Harington reprising his role in the new project. However, the actor during his appearance on a panel at the Superhero Comic-Con and Car Show addressed the rumors stating,

“The honest answer is I think that’s the intention with the character. I think there was some misunderstanding about whether he was going to be in the ‘Blade’ movie. He was never meant to be in the ‘Blade’ movie and isn’t.”

While the actor is interested in reprising his role, he concluded by sharing he knew nothing about it. It surely disappointed the fans who took to Twitter to share their thoughts.

The change in release time is directly proportional to the continuous production delays, rewrites, and ongoing Writer’s Guild strike. As per the earlier reports, the titular star’s disapproval of the film script led to several rewrites let alone changes, which highly delayed the production process. Originally slated for a 2024 release, it is now expected to hit theaters on June 04, 2025.
